Synchronization between two complex dynamical networks with time delay coupling and circumstance noise
The synchronization between two complex networks with time delay coupling and circumstance noise in the transmission channel is studied in this paper. Two kinds of networks are studied including states coupled and outputs coupled. In order to suppress the effect introduced by the noise, the synchronization controllers are designed by using the integral control approach. Some sufficient conditions of synchronization between two complex networks are derived in the form of linear matrix inequalities (LMIs) by using Lyapunov stability theory and H∞ control approach. The synchronization errors are convergent to zeros with H∞ performance index. Finally, two numerical examples are given to demonstrate the validity and effectiveness of the controllers proposed in the paper.
